Is there any way to check that the timing belt hasn't skipped any teeth?

I was putting the transmission back in and ended up turning the drive shaft both ways before I realized that I shouldn't have done it. I'll rest easier starting the engine after I've confirmed that it's correct. Thank you!

Carson the simplest way is to get your crank pulley to TDC and then remove the two round plastic covers in front of the camshaft pulleys.There are pointers which should line up with marks on the face of the pulleys,
